3. Thread stress

Thread stress performs a vital function in free-motion machine embroidery, immediately influencing the standard and look of the stitching. Correct stress ensures that the higher and decrease threads interlock accurately throughout the cloth layers, making a clean, balanced sew. Incorrect stress can result in quite a lot of points, together with free, crazy stitches on the highest or backside floor, puckering of the material, and even thread breakage. The perfect stress setting varies relying on the material kind, thread weight, and needle dimension, requiring cautious adjustment and testing earlier than starting a challenge. As an illustration, delicate materials like silk require a lighter stress than heavier supplies like denim. Equally, thicker threads necessitate a barely greater stress in comparison with finer threads. Contemplate the impact of stress on a densely stitched motif. Inadequate stress may trigger the design to look raised and uneven, whereas extreme stress may pull the material inwards, creating ugly puckers.

Balancing the strain between the higher and decrease threads is crucial for reaching professional-looking outcomes. The higher thread stress is managed by the strain dial on the stitching machine, whereas the bobbin stress, although much less regularly adjusted, additionally contributes to the general steadiness. Testing the strain on a scrap of the challenge cloth earlier than starting ensures optimum settings and avoids wasted supplies. This take a look at entails stitching a pattern design and inspecting each side of the material. A balanced stress ends in stitches which might be clean and flat, with the interlocking threads hidden throughout the cloth layers. Visible inspection reveals any imbalances, prompting changes to both the higher or bobbin stress till the specified result’s achieved. For advanced designs with various sew densities, delicate stress changes could also be wanted in the course of the stitching course of to keep up consistency.

4. Sew regulation

Sew regulation performs a significant function in free-motion machine embroidery, impacting sew consistency and general design high quality. On this method, in contrast to customary stitching the place feed canines advance the material uniformly, sew size is decided by the velocity of cloth motion below the needle and the stitching machine’s velocity. This dynamic requires exact coordination between hand motion and machine operation. Sew regulation provides help in sustaining constant sew size no matter cloth manipulation velocity. Two major strategies of sew regulation exist: handbook and digital. Guide regulation depends solely on the sewer’s talent in coordinating hand and foot management, requiring appreciable follow and finesse. Digital sew regulation, provided in some specialised stitching machines, offers computerized help in sustaining constant sew size. This know-how senses cloth motion and adjusts the stitching machine’s velocity accordingly, lowering the burden on the sewer and enhancing precision, particularly useful for intricate designs and ranging cloth thicknesses.

Contemplate the affect of sew regulation on a fancy design that includes each dense fill stitching and delicate define work. With out constant sew size, the dense areas may seem uneven and the outlines irregular. Guide regulation calls for targeted management, rising the chance of inconsistencies, notably in areas requiring intricate maneuvering. Digital sew regulation, nevertheless, minimizes these challenges by robotically adjusting the sew size, permitting the sewer to give attention to design execution and cloth manipulation. Think about stitching an in depth feather motif on a sheer cloth. Sustaining uniform sew size alongside the fragile curves is essential for a cultured end result. Digital regulation offers the required assist, compensating for delicate variations in hand velocity and making certain exact sew placement all through the design. 6. Stabilizer choice

Stabilizer choice is a important facet of free-motion machine embroidery, considerably impacting the steadiness of the material and the standard of the stitching. Stabilizers present short-term assist to the material in the course of the stitching course of, stopping distortion, puckering, and undesirable stretching. Selecting the suitable stabilizer ensures clear sew formation, prevents design misalignment, and contributes to knowledgeable end. The varied vary of stabilizers obtainable caters to completely different cloth varieties and challenge necessities, underscoring the significance of knowledgeable choice.

  • Reduce-Away Stabilizer

    Reduce-away stabilizers present strong assist for dense stitching and complicated designs. This sort stays completely affixed to the again of the material after stitching, providing continued assist and stopping design distortion over time. Excellent for tasks like embroidered logos on attire or densely stitched free-motion designs on quilts, cut-away stabilizers present a steady basis, stopping the material from stretching or puckering below the stress of dense stitching. The surplus stabilizer is trimmed away after stitching, leaving a skinny layer of assist behind the design. This selection is especially related for materials liable to stretching or designs requiring long-term sturdiness.

  • Tear-Away Stabilizer

    Tear-away stabilizers provide short-term assist throughout stitching and are simply eliminated as soon as the design is full. This sort is well-suited for tasks requiring much less dense stitching and materials with inherent stability, similar to woven cotton or linen. Tear-away stabilizers present sufficient assist throughout stitching whereas permitting for clear elimination with out damaging the material. Think about using tear-away stabilizer for tasks like ornamental stitching on dwelling dcor objects or light-weight embroidery on clothes. Its ease of elimination makes it a handy selection for tasks the place a everlasting backing is pointless.

  • Wash-Away Stabilizer

    Wash-away stabilizers dissolve in water, making them best for tasks the place a everlasting stabilizer is undesirable, similar to freestanding lace or intricate embroidery that requires a clear end. This sort offers short-term assist throughout stitching and is definitely eliminated by rinsing the completed piece in water. Contemplate wash-away stabilizer for delicate materials like lace or embroidery designs that will likely be uncovered on each side of the material. Its full elimination ensures a gentle, pure really feel and avoids any stiffness or bulk {that a} everlasting stabilizer may introduce. This selection is especially related for objects that require frequent washing, because the stabilizer will dissolve fully, leaving no residue.

  • Warmth-Away Stabilizer

    Warmth-away stabilizers disappear upon utility of warmth, making them appropriate for tasks involving delicate materials or intricate designs the place residue from different stabilizers may be undesirable. This sort offers short-term assist and is eliminated by ironing the completed piece. Warmth-away stabilizers are notably helpful for embroidery on delicate materials like silk or velvet, the place tearing or washing may harm the fabric. They’re additionally useful for intricate appliqu work the place clear edges are important. This stabilizer kind provides a clear end with out altering the material’s texture or drape, making it a flexible choice for a variety of tasks.

7. Needle selection

Needle selection considerably influences the success of free-motion machine embroidery. Choosing the suitable needle kind and dimension ensures correct thread supply, prevents cloth harm, and contributes to the general high quality of the stitching. An unsuitable needle can result in skipped stitches, thread breakage, and even harm to the material, highlighting the significance of cautious needle choice.

  • Needle Level

    Needle level fashion is a vital consideration. Common factors are appropriate for many woven materials. Ballpoint needles are designed for knit materials, stopping snags and runs. Sharp factors, generally used for microfibers and silks, create a exact gap for the thread, minimizing cloth distortion. Selecting the proper level kind prevents harm to the material and ensures clear sew formation.

  • Needle Dimension

    Needle dimension is denoted by a quantity system, with decrease numbers indicating finer needles and better numbers indicating thicker needles. The needle dimension must be acceptable for the thread weight and cloth kind. Utilizing too superb a needle with a heavy thread may cause the thread to interrupt, whereas too thick a needle can depart seen holes within the cloth. Matching the needle dimension to the thread and cloth ensures clean stitching and prevents harm.

  • Needle Sort

    Particular needle varieties cater to explicit threads and methods. Embroidery needles have a bigger eye to accommodate thicker embroidery threads. Metallic needles are designed to be used with metallic threads, minimizing friction and stopping shredding. Topstitch needles have an extra-large eye to accommodate thicker topstitching threads. Choosing the proper needle kind optimizes thread supply and sew high quality.

  • Needle Situation

    Needle situation immediately impacts sew high quality. Bent or uninteresting needles may cause skipped stitches, thread breakage, and cloth harm. Usually altering needles, ideally after each 8-10 hours of sewing, ensures optimum efficiency and prevents points. Inspecting needles for harm and changing them promptly is essential for sustaining sew high quality and stopping challenge setbacks.

Often Requested Questions

This part addresses frequent queries concerning free-motion machine embroidery, providing sensible insights and clarifying potential misconceptions.

Query 1: What distinguishes free-motion machine embroidery from customary machine embroidery?

Free-motion machine embroidery entails reducing or protecting the feed canines and manipulating cloth manually below the needle. This enables for full management over sew path and size, enabling intricate designs and inventive expression. Normal machine embroidery makes use of pre-programmed designs and automatic cloth development through the feed canines.

Query 2: What kind of stitching machine is required for free-motion embroidery?

Most stitching machines with a drop feed canine characteristic can be utilized. Specialised free-motion quilting machines provide extra options like sew regulation, enhancing sew consistency. Nevertheless, even fundamental machines with adjustable feed canines can accommodate this method.

Query 3: Is a particular presser foot essential?

A darning or free-motion foot is crucial. This specialised foot hovers barely above the material, permitting for unimpeded motion throughout stitching. Its open design offers clear visibility of the stitching space, important for precision and complicated maneuvering.

Query 4: What kinds of threads are appropriate for free-motion machine embroidery?

Most embroidery threads work nicely, together with rayon, polyester, and cotton. Thread weight must be chosen based mostly on the specified impact and cloth kind. Experimentation is inspired to find most popular thread varieties and weights for particular tasks.

Query 5: How does one management sew size in free-motion embroidery?

Sew size is managed by the velocity of cloth motion below the needle and the stitching machine’s velocity. Constant sew size requires follow and coordination. Some machines provide digital sew regulation, which robotically adjusts the machine velocity to keep up constant stitching no matter cloth motion velocity.

Query 6: What are frequent challenges encountered in free-motion machine embroidery, and the way can they be addressed?

Uneven sew size, thread breakage, and cloth puckering are frequent challenges. These can typically be resolved by means of adjusting thread stress, utilizing acceptable stabilizers, deciding on the proper needle kind and dimension, and training constant hand-eye-foot coordination.
